To communicate more effectively I have to first know
and understand what areas of communication I may lack in. We often think that
our way is the right way. That is definitely not true. We all have some areas
that we need to improve and there are some things about communication we were
not aware of. We have to make sure we truly understand what it means to communicate
effectively. The second thing I can do is to not be so grounded in thinking
that my cultural ways are what’s appropriate. This is called cultural myopia.
Cultural myopia is especially dangerous when members of the dominant group in a
society are unaware of or insensitive toward the needs and values of members of
others in the same society. Third I can apply the platinum rule when I am
communicating with others. The platinum rule states, “Do to others as they
themselves would like to be treated." Which goes hand in hand with valuing
and respecting others. As it relates to effective communication, if we are
aware of and are knowledgeable of the different cultures we can then
communicate with them in a way that does not suggest we don’t appreciate who
they are.
